#157cb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#157cb4 is composed of 8.2% red, 48.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 201.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#157cb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2af8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#157cb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#157cb4 has RGB values of R:21, G:124,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1408180.

Shades and Tints of #157cb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#157cb4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626567 is the less saturated color, while #0681c3 is the most saturated one.
